Roof Jump Stunt Driver

  • First released on 6 January, 2023 for Nintendo Switch

    About

    Become a pro stunt driver and take your skills to a completely new level! Complete the most extreme driving and parking missions with precision and style. Jump from rooftop to rooftop, navigate steep platforms and complete all of the stunt driving courses!

    FEATURES:

    ▶ 10 EXCITING CARS: A varied and exciting car collection

    ▶ VERTICAL DRIVING CHALLENGE: High speed racing across rooftops!

    ▶ STUNTS & TRICKS: Show your courage and skill!

    ▶ 50 DEMANDING MISSIONS: Complete them all!

    To prove yourself as the most proficient and skillful driver you will have to enter a rooftop arena and show your driving and drifting skills. Completing all of the challenges will require truly mad skills and experience as a driver prepared to face the most extreme circumstances.

    You will have to show your ability to control ten different vehicles. Each one of them poses a challenge on its own. Discovering their strong and weak points is a part of the game!
